Before anything else, you need to clearly define who your customers are. Knowing their demographics, preferences, and online behavior helps you design an experience that resonates with them. If you’re selling high-end fashion, your website design and product descriptions will differ greatly from a store selling home improvement tools.

A significant percentage of online shopping happens on smartphones. If your eCommerce site isn’t mobile-optimized, you risk losing a large chunk of potential customers. Test your site across multiple devices to ensure fast load times, easy navigation, and smooth checkout on mobile.
Your payment gateway should offer multiple options — credit cards, debit cards, PayPal, and other popular methods. Equally important is security; using SSL certificates and PCI-compliant payment systems protects customer data and builds trust.
SEO is essential for bringing in organic traffic. This means optimizing product pages with relevant keywords, writing unique descriptions, and ensuring your site structure is search engine–friendly. You can’t improve what you don’t measure. Set up analytics tools to track website traffic, bounce rate, conversion rate, and other key metrics. A conversion rate optimization expert can interpret this data to identify problem areas and implement strategies that improve sales.
High-quality images, detailed product descriptions, and clear pricing are essential for product pages. Adding customer reviews, trust badges, and “Frequently Bought Together” suggestions can also boost conversions.
Decide on your inventory management process before launch. Will you use in-house storage or partner with a fulfillment center? Shipping costs, times, and return policies should be clear and competitive to avoid cart abandonment.
Broken links, missing images, or malfunctioning checkout systems can frustrate customers and cost you sales. Conduct thorough usability testing before going live. An eCommerce agency can perform pre-launch audits to ensure everything works flawlessly.
A great website won’t generate sales without marketing. Email campaigns, paid ads, and social media promotions should be ready to roll out as soon as your site launches. Offering excellent customer service can set you apart from competitors. Provide multiple contact options — live chat, email, and phone — and respond promptly to inquiries. Adding an FAQ section can also help customers find answers quickly.
